It is a general tests designed to detect any linear forms of heteroskedasticity. Breusch-Pagan test helps to check the null hypothesis versus the alternative hypothesis. In Excel with the XLSTAT software. The following links provide quick access to summaries of the help command reference material. E.g. In our example, X2 = 10 * 0.600395 = 6.00395. If you don’t see this option, then you need to first, Once you click on Data Analysis, a new window will pop up. The test statistic, a Lagrange multiplier measure, is distributed Chi-squared(p) under the null hypothesis of homoskedasticity. So by giving a filter option to the data by using the short cut key Ctrl+Shift+L we can select the variables for which we are looking out for variance. This test can be used in the following way. Get the spreadsheets here: Try out our free online statistics calculators if you’re looking for some help finding probabilities, p-values, critical values, sample sizes, expected values, summary statistics, or correlation coefficients. Your email address will not be published. Heteroskedasticity is an important concept in regression modeling, and in the investment world, regression models are used to explain the performance of securities and investment portfolios. This article describes the formula, syntax and usage of the NumXL ARCH effect statistical test (ARCHTest) function in Microsoft Excel We derive tests for heteroskedasticity after fixed effects estimation of linear panel [8] proposed a conditional LM test for heteroskedasticity for panel data models with serial.. This test takes the form. Statology is a site that makes learning statistics easy. One test that we can use to determine if heteroscedasticity is present is the Breusch-Pagan Test. Although heteroskedasticity can sometimes be identified by eye, Section 19.4 presents a formal hypothesis test to detect heteroskedasticity. Select. Heteroscedasticity produces a distinctive fan or cone shape in residualplots. If the ’s are not independent or their variances are not constant, the parameter estimates are unbiased, but the estimate of the covariance matrix is inconsistent. We use the subtotal function in excel. The package sandwich is a dependency of the package AER , meaning that it is attached automatically if you load AER . import pandas as pd import numpy as np from matplotlib import pyplot as plt Load the data set and plot the dependent variable Test for Heteroskedasticity with the White Test By Roberto Pedace In econometrics, an extremely common test for heteroskedasticity is the White test, which begins by allowing the heteroskedasticity process to be a function of one or more of your independent variables. Section 19.5 describes the most common way in which econometricians handle the problem of heteroskedasticity – using a modified computation of the estimated SE that yields correct reported SEs. Copyright © 2020 Addinsoft. Next, we will find the p-value associated with this test statistic. where m = the number of independent variables in the second regression, not counting the constant term. 817–38. TESTING FOR MULTICOLLINEARITY USING MICROSOFT EXCEL Page 9 You would observe you have a new tab Data in the Microsoft excel windows display Click on the Data tab, this would appear STEP FIVE: Arrange the data in order in which they would be regressed in the microsoft excel file with each arrangement in separate excel sheets. Breusch Pagan test (named after Trevor Breusch and Adrian Pagan) is used to test for heteroscedasticity in a linear regression model. Run regression of residuals against explanatory variables or alternatively against the dependent variable In e2i = B1 + B2 In Xi + vi 4. whitetst computes the White (1980) general test for heteroskedasticity in the error distribution by regressing the squared residuals on all distinct regressors, cross-products, and squares of regressors. Breusch-Pagan & White heteroscedasticity tests let you check if the residuals of a regression have changing variance. To calculate the predicted values, we will use the coefficients from the regression output: We will use the same formula to obtain each predicted value: Next, we will calculate the squared residuals for each prediction: We will use the same formula to obtain each squared residual: Step 3: Perform a new multiple linear regression using the squared residuals as the response values. For this purpose, there are a couple of tests that comes handy to establish the presence or absence of heteroscedasticity – The Breush-Pagan test and the NCV test. To check for heteroscedasticity, you need to assess the residuals by fitted valueplots specifically. We do not have sufficient evidence to say that heteroscedasticity is present in the original regression model. Fill in the necessary arrays for the response variables and the explanatory variables, then click OK. This test produces a Chi-Square test statistic and a corresponding p-value. Also, misspecification can cause heteroskedasticity. The most widely used test for heteroscedasticity is the Breusch-Pagan test. A null hypothesis is that where the error variances are all equal (homoscedasticity), whereas the alternative hypothesis states that the error variances are a multiplicative function of one or more variables (heteroscedasticity). This site uses cookies and other tracking technologies to assist with navigation and your ability to provide feedback, analyse your use of our products and services, assist with our promotional and marketing efforts, and provide content from third parties. using a regression model that includes independent variables x 1 and x 2 but excludes x 1 2 or x 1 ⋅ x 2 when one of these is relevant. Null Hypothesis: Equal/constant variances. In econometrics, an informal way of checking for heteroskedasticity is with a graphical examination of the residuals. Let’s run the White test for heteroscedasticity using Python on the gold price index data set (found over here).. Your email address will not be published. The following topics show how to test for heteroskedasticity. Homoscedastic t-tests are based on the assumption that variances between two sample data ranges are equal [(Argument1) = (Argument2)]. This test uses multiple linear regression, where the outcome variable is the squared residuals. The math is a little much for this post, but many statistical programs will calculate it for you. How to Perform a Breusch-Pagan Test in Excel Step 1: Perform multiple linear regression. First we will calculate the Chi-Square test statistic using the formula: R2new = R Square of the “new” regression in which the squared residuals were used as the response variable. If the p-value is below a certain threshold (common choices are 0.01, 0.05, and 0.10) then there is sufficient evidence to say that heteroscedasticity is present. All Rights Reserved. Once you click on Data Analysis, a new window will pop up. White Test for Heteroskedasticity. It is interpreted the same way as a chi-square test. their log. In linear regression analysis, the fact that the errors of the model (also named residuals) are not homoskedastic has the consequence that the model coefficients estimated using ordinary least squares (OLS) are neither unbiased nor those with minimum variance. The predictors are the same predictor variable as used in the original model. It tests whether the variance of the errors from a regression is dependent on the values of the independent variables. Step 2: Calculate the squared residuals. It is used to test for heteroskedasticity in a linear regression model and assumes that the error terms are normally distributed. How to Calculate Relative Standard Deviation in Excel, How to Interpolate Missing Values in Excel, Linear Interpolation in Excel: Step-by-Step Example. Breush Pagan Test. Concentrating on the variable of age group we can check on the variance of the band of the same variable and conclude on heteroskedasticity. The estimation of their variance is not reliable. It is a χ 2 test. 3. Park test 1. A Breusch-Pagan Test is used to determine if heteroscedasticity is present in a regression analysis. • The White test is an asymptotic Wald-type test, normality is not needed. It does not depend on the assumption that the errors are normally distributed. The researcher then fits the model to the data by obtaining the absolute value of the residual and then ranking them in ascending or … The White Test. White’s Test. Approximations exist for more than two groups, and they are both called Box's M test. ↩︎ Required fields are marked *. Assume our regression model is Y i = β 1 + β 2 X 2 i + μ i i.e we have simple linear regression model, and E (μ i 2) = σ i 2, where σ i 2 = f (α 1 + α 2 Z 2 i), Along the top ribbon in Excel, go to the Data tab and click on Data Analysis. Using these links is the quickest way of finding all of the relevant EViews commands and functions associated with a general topic such as equations, strings, or statistical distributions. In our case, the degrees of freedom is the number shown for, How to Create and Interpret a Correlation Matrix in Excel. The concept of heteroscedasticity - the opposite being homoscedasticity - is used in statistics, especially in the context of linear regression or for time series analysis, to describe the case where the variance of errors or the model is not the same for all observations, while often one of the basic assumption in modeling is that the variances are homogeneous and that the errors of the model are … It has the following advantages: It does not require you to specify a model of the structure of the heteroscedasticity, if it exists. If you don’t see this option, then you need to first install the free Analysis ToolPak. For systems of equations, these tests are computed separately for the residuals of each equation. White’s Test for Heteroscedasticity is a more robust test that tests whether all the variances are equal across your data if it is not normally distributed. The white test of heteroscedasticity is a general test for the detection of heteroscdsticity existence in data set. Testing for Heteroscedasticity The regression model is specified as , where the ’s are identically and independently distributed: and . Run the original regression 2. NCV Test Typically, the telltale pattern for heteroscedasticity is that as the fitted valuesincreases, … “A Heteroskedasticity-Consistent Covariance Matrix Estimator and a Direct Test for Heteroskedasticity.” Econometrica 48 (4): pp. Breusch Pagan Test was introduced by Trevor Breusch and Adrian Pagan in 1979. Both White’s test and the Breusch-Pagan are based on the residuals of the fitted model. lmtest::bptest(lmMod) # Breusch-Pagan test studentized Breusch-Pagan test data: lmMod BP = 3.2149, df = 1, p-value = 0.07297. Bartlett's test for heteroscedasticity between grouped data, used most commonly in the univariate case, has also been extended for the multivariate case, but a tractable solution only exists for 2 groups. Thus, our formula becomes: Because this p-value is not less than 0.05, we fail to reject the null hypothesis. Step 1: Perform multiple linear regression. Then we will perform a Breusch-Pagan Test to determine if heteroscedasticity is present in the regression. Fill in the necessary arrays for the response variables and the explanatory variables, then click OK. Next, we will calculate the predicted values and the squared residuals for each response value. The following are invalid conditions: Heteroscedastic t-tests are based on the assumption that variances between two sample data ranges are unequal [(Argument1) ¹ (Argument2)]. See our Cookie policy. Several tests have been developed, with the following null and alternative hypotheses: A complete statistical add-in for Microsoft Excel. In our case, the degrees of freedom is the number shown for df of regression in the output. Regress ûi2 against a constant term and all the explanatory variables from either the Breusch-Pagan test for heteroscedasticity (e.g., when k =2: ûi2 = α0 + α1X1i + α2X2i + vi ) or the White test for heteroscedasticity: ûi2 = α0 + α1X1i + α2X2i + α3X1i2 + α4X2i2 + α5X1i X2i + vi Step 3. Testing for Heteroskedasticity: Testing Graphically; Breusch-Pagan Test; White Test Here is the output of that regression: Lastly, we will perform the Breusch-Pagan Test to see if heteroscedasticity was present in the original regression. The concept of heteroscedasticity - the opposite being homoscedasticity - is used in statistics, especially in the context of linear regression or for time series analysis, to describe the case where the variance of errors or the model is not the same for all observations, while often one of the basic assumption in modeling is that the variances are homogeneous and that the errors of the model are identically distributed. If it is suspected that the variances are not homogeneous (a representation of the residuals against the explanatory variables may reveal heteroscedasticity), it is therefore necessary to perform a test for heteroscedasticity. This test is similar to the Breusch-Pagan Test, except that in the second OLS regression, in addition to the variables x1, …, xk we also include the independent variables x12, …, xk2 as well as x1xj for all i ≠ j. A formal test called Spearman’s rank correlation test is used by the researcher to detect the presence of heteroscedasticity. Along the top ribbon in Excel, go to the Data tab and click on Data Analysis. Suppose the researcher assumes a simple linear model, Yi = ß0 + ß1Xi + ui, to detect heteroscedasticity. In this case, it’s 3. Obtain the residuals, square them and take. For this purpose, there are a couple of tests that comes handy to establish the presence or absence of heteroscedasticity – The Breush-Pagan test and the NCV test. We will fit a multiple linear regression model using rating as the response variable and points, assists, and rebounds as the explanatory variables. It is used to test for heteroskedasticity in a linear regression model. Breusch Pagan Test was introduced by Trevor Breusch and Adrian Pagan in 1979. For this example we will use the following dataset that describes the attributes of 10 basketball players. Learn more. Get the formula sheet here: Statistics in Excel Made Easy is a collection of 16 Excel spreadsheets that contain built-in formulas to perform the most commonly used statistical tests. The MODEL procedure provides two tests for heteroscedasticity of the errors: White’s test and the modified Breusch-Pagan test. This tutorial explains how to perform a Breusch-Pagan Test in Excel. Import all the required packages. Heteroscedasticity Tests. Next, we will perform the same steps as before to conduct multiple linear regression using points, assists, and rebounds as the explanatory variables, except we will use the squared residuals as the response values this time. • The BP test is an LM test, based on the score of the log likelihood function, calculated under normality. Select Regression and click OK. It test whether variance of errors from a regression is dependent on the values of a independent variable. Testing for heteroscedasticity using Python and statsmodels. If you want to use graphs for an examination of heteroskedasticity, you first choose an independent variable that’s likely to be responsible for the heteroskedasticity. Breush Pagan Test lmtest::bptest(lmMod) # Breusch-Pagan test studentized Breusch-Pagan test data: lmMod BP = 3.2149, df = 1, p-value = 0.07297 The Elementary Statistics Formula Sheet is a printable formula sheet that contains the formulas for the most common confidence intervals and hypothesis tests in Elementary Statistics, all neatly arranged on one page. Along the top ribbon in Excel, go to the Data tab and click on Data Analysis. We can use the following formula in Excel to do so: =CHISQ.DIST.RT(test statistic, degrees of freedom). Following formula in Excel statistic, a new window will pop up for heteroskedasticity in a linear regression, counting... Econometrica 48 ( 4 ): pp following dataset that describes the attributes of 10 players. And a Direct test for the detection of heteroscdsticity existence in Data set a new window will up! Age group we can use the following links provide quick access to summaries of package. = the number shown for, how to Perform a Breusch-Pagan test against. Perform a Breusch-Pagan test in Excel Step 1: Perform multiple linear regression.... It test whether variance of the independent variables in the regression model the Breusch-Pagan are based the... If you don ’ t see this option, then click OK ) under the hypothesis! Using Python on the gold price index Data set ( found over here ) ’ t see this,! Outcome variable is the squared residuals for, how to test for residuals. Fitted valueplots specifically or alternatively against the dependent variable in e2i = B1 + B2 Xi. Go to the Data tab and click on Data Analysis, a Lagrange multiplier measure, is Chi-squared! S run the White test for heteroscedasticity in a linear regression, where the ’ s identically... Counting the constant term, these tests are computed separately for the response variables and the Breusch-Pagan is. = B1 + B2 in Xi + vi 4 Breusch-Pagan test if heteroscedasticity is present in the output predictor as... Pagan in 1979 variable of age group we can check on the values of independent. Designed to detect any linear forms of heteroskedasticity tests whether the variance of the independent variables in the original model. Once you click on Data Analysis click OK the error terms are normally distributed the top ribbon in,. Statistics easy = ß0 + ß1Xi + ui, to detect any linear of! Following topics show how to Perform a Breusch-Pagan test in Excel, go to Data... The residuals of the same way as a chi-square test statistic, degrees of freedom the... Math is a dependency of the package AER, meaning that it interpreted. Do so: =CHISQ.DIST.RT ( test statistic, degrees of freedom ) the following are invalid conditions: test... We fail to reject the null hypothesis versus the alternative hypothesis • the test. Next, we will Perform a Breusch-Pagan test helps to check the null hypothesis =. Model and assumes that the errors are normally distributed is not needed is to! Each equation measure, is distributed Chi-squared ( p ) under the hypothesis. Second regression, not counting the constant term regression have changing variance number shown for df regression! = 10 * 0.600395 = 6.00395 meaning that it is interpreted heteroscedasticity test in excel same variable and conclude heteroskedasticity... Find the p-value associated with this test uses multiple linear regression model for... ( found over here ) are computed separately for the response variables and the are. Original regression model a little much for this example we will use the dataset... Original model normally distributed have been developed, with the following topics how... Freedom is heteroscedasticity test in excel squared residuals the degrees of freedom is the Breusch-Pagan is. A Lagrange multiplier measure, is distributed Chi-squared ( p ) under null! If the residuals by fitted valueplots specifically White test for heteroskedasticity in a linear,... Quick access to summaries of the package AER, meaning that it is interpreted same... Used by the researcher to detect any linear forms of heteroskedasticity each.... Uses multiple linear regression tests let you check if the residuals of each equation model!
How To Calculate Relative Molecular Mass Of A Gas, Jacuzzi Shower Head, How Deep Is The Muskegon River, Thomas Nelson Course Searchdoes Mazda Use Timing Chains Or Belts, What Is The Meaning Of Ar, Jacuzzi Shower Head, Ply Gem 1500 Warranty, Maharani College Mysore Hostel, Altra Provision 3 Women's, World Physiotherapy Day 2020 Theme,